What is the ÖSD?
The ÖSD is an internationally recognized evaluation and evaluation system for German as a Foreign Language and German as a Second Language. Established in 1994 on the initiative of Austrian federal ministries, it aligns with the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R).
Unlike some language certificates that focus entirely on German as spoken in Germany, the ÖSD takes a "pluricentric" approach. This means it acknowledges and includes the linguistic ranges of German spoken in Austria, Germany, and Switzerland, making it an especially flexible qualification for anybody moving to the DACH area.
Does the ÖSD Certificate Expire?
From a technical and legal viewpoint, the ÖSD certificate itself does not have an expiration date. As soon as an individual successfully passes the exam and gets the diploma, the certificate remains valid indefinitely as a record of their accomplishment at that particular point in time.
Nevertheless, the "validity" of the certificate is typically determined by the receiving organization rather than the releasing body. While the ÖSD Prüfung A1 Kosten organization considers the diploma life-long, 3rd parties-- such as migration offices, universities, and employers-- typically enforce their own time limitations.
Typical Institutional Requirements
Many institutions require that a language certificate be "current" to ensure that the prospect's present language skills still match the level suggested on the document. Language skills can lessen with time if not practiced, which is why organizations beware.

Among the most substantial benefits of the ÖSD is its modular structure, especially at the B1 Prüfung ÖSD, B2, and C1 levels. These exams are divided into modules: Reading, Listening, Writing, and Speaking.
Candidates do not necessarily have to pass all modules at the very same time. If a prospect passes two modules however fails the others, they receive a modular certificate.

Does the ÖSD certificate expire after 2 years?
No, the certificate itself does not end. Nevertheless, many immigration authorities and universities just accept certificates provided within the last 2 years.
2. Can I get a replacement if I lose my ÖSD certificate?
Yes. Candidates can request a replicate from the exam center where they took the test or directly from the ÖSD head office in Vienna, supplied the exam was taken within the last 10 years. A cost is usually involved.
3. Is the ÖSD accepted for German citizenship?
Yes, the ÖSD is extensively accepted for citizenship and residency applications in Germany, just as the Goethe-Zertifikat is accepted in Austria.
4. What is the difference in between ÖSD and ÖIF?
The ÖIF (Österreichischer Integrationsfonds) exam is particularly created for combination purposes in Austria and consists of an area on worths and orientation. The ÖSD is a general language diploma with wider global and academic recognition.
5. Can I integrate modules from various exam centers?
Typically, yes. Modules passed at various authorized ÖSD centers can typically be integrated into a single diploma, provided they are completed within the needed timeframe (generally one year).
